  • Q1. What is lel & uel of hydrogen?
  • Ans. 

    LEL (Lower Explosive Limit) and UEL (Upper Explosive Limit) are the concentration range of a gas in air that can result in an explosion if ignited.

    • LEL of hydrogen is 4% in air

    • UEL of hydrogen is 75% in air

    • Concentrations below LEL are too lean to burn, while concentrations above UEL are too rich to burn

  • Q2. What is the Pressure units.?
  • Ans. 

    Pressure units are used to measure the force exerted on a surface per unit area.

    • Pressure is typically measured in units such as pascal (Pa), bar, psi, or atmosphere (atm).

    • 1 pascal (Pa) is equal to 1 newton per square meter (N/m²).

    • 1 bar is approximately equal to atmospheric pressure at sea level (1 atm).

    • 1 psi (pound per square inch) is equal to approximately 6895 pascals (Pa).
